Overview

Property Records Specialist within Raytheon Property Operations Records Management Team. Supports property records management activities in a complex environment responsible for managing government, customer, and company property records. Contributes to a culture of improvement and efficiency, driving innovative solutions and affordability. Communicates effectively with customers to shape proactive relationships and ensure compliance with regulations, data integrity, audit protocols, and company policies.

Responsibilities
  • Support property records management activities in a complex environment for government, customer, and company property records.
  • Participate in a culture of improvement and efficiency, driving innovative solutions and affordability within the property records organization.
  • Communicate with customers (internal and external) to shape proactive relationships and ensure compliance with regulations, data integrity, records accuracy, and audit protocols.
Qualifications
  • Typically requires a University Degree or equivalent experience and minimum five (5) years of relevant experience, or an Advanced Degree with minimum three (3) years of experience.
  • Experience with Logistics, Operations, Contracts, Programs, Government Property, or Supply Chain.
  • U.S. citizenship is required, as only U.S. citizens are authorized to access information under this program/contract.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in government property and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) / (DFAR) compliance, interpreting and implementing contract property requirements.
  • Excellent communication, both oral and written, to collaborate with Engineering, Logistics, Manufacturing, Operations, Programs, Property, Supply Chain, and Customers.
  • Working knowledge of SAP and asset ERP systems; adv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Teams, Word) including macros and formulas.
  • Knowledge of SharePoint; ability to adapt to changing situations and urgent requests; ability to build and maintain relationships; self-starter with minimal supervision; ability to manage priorities.
  • Ability to identify issues and drive process improvements; previous DoD experience;
    National Property Management Association, CPPS certification or ability to obtain within 1 year.
